Water Resistance Levels

Thinking about wearing your smart ring all day, even while swimming or showering? Water resistance levels tell you how well a ring can handle water. Most smart rings have an IP68 rating, which means they can be used while swimming, in the shower, or diving. You can wear it in the pool without concern. But some rings have a lower rating like IP67. These protect against splashes but may not last long in water. Always check your ring’s water resistance rating before using it in water. Different brands may have different standards. Knowing this helps you choose a ring that matches your water activities. Whether you take a bath, run in the rain, or dive deep, a high water resistance rating keeps your health tracker safe and looks good.

How Accurate Are Smart Rings Compared to Traditional Health Devices?

Smart rings are generally quite accurate, especially for basic health metrics like heart rate and sleep tracking. However, they may not match advanced traditional devices for medical-grade measurements, so use them for everyday health insights and not medical diagnosis.

Can Smart Rings Detect Early Signs of Health Issues?

Yes, smart rings can detect early signs of health issues by monitoring crucial signs like heart rate and sleep patterns. They alert you to anomalies, helping you seek medical advice sooner and potentially preventing serious health problems.

How Long Does the Battery Typically Last on Smart Rings?

Smart rings typically last between 1 to 7 days on a single charge, depending on the model and usage. You need to recharge them regularly, usually through a wireless charger, to keep tracking your health seamlessly.

Are Smart Rings Suitable for All Skin Types?

Smart rings generally suit most skin types, but if you have sensitive or allergic skin, you should check the material used. Opt for hypoallergenic options to prevent irritation and guarantee comfortable, safe wear for extended periods.

Do Smart Rings Emit Radiation That Could Affect Health?

Smart rings emit very low levels of non-ionizing radiation, similar to cell phones or Wi-Fi devices, which most experts agree are safe for daily use. You’re unlikely to experience health effects from normal smart ring usage.
